Responsibilities
Senior Project Manager, Rare Disease position works directly with various business stakeholders including PELS, Case Managers, Legal and Compliance to lead initiatives which will transform the PPS organization. A successful candidate must have experience documenting business processes and suggesting improvements. The position liaises with the IT organization to drive the identification and delivery of solutions to fulfill unmet business needs.
This role requires relationship management, business analysis, and project management skills as well as knowledge of various applications such as Salesforce.com, Veeva, Data Warehouse, and Processes etc.
Responsibilities include but are not limited to
Business Case Development:
Collaborates with Director of Platform Solutions and PPS Leadership team to establish scope and business case for new programs and initiatives.
Stakeholder Engagement:
Build relationships with key business stakeholders and become a trusted advocate for the business, advocating for critical initiatives.
During project initiation, collaborate with project sponsors to define objectives and resource managers for project staffing.
Facilitate workshops with business stakeholders to gather and document user requirements, challenging assumptions to find the best solutions.
Perform process mapping of As IS and To Be processes in conjunction with business stakeholders.
Leverage process improvement tools to streamline business processes.
Project Management
Drive the execution and delivery of solutions by managing cross-functional stakeholders including IT and Business functions.
Provide project status updates leveraging weekly status reports, risk log, risk mitigation plan and project dashboards etc.
Collaborate with project team to develop project timelines and develop appropriate risk mitigation strategies, contingency plans, etc.
Roadmap Execution
Collaborate with ITS to identify technical functionality that aligns with desired new business capabilities by participating in vendor demos, proof of concept design reviews (POCs) and sprint releases.
Identify opportunities to innovate and differentiate Rare Disease from its competition
User Acceptance Testing:
Collaborates with business stakeholders and ITS to define user acceptance criteria.
Accountable for test script development, ensuring test scripts reflect user acceptance criteria.
Performs functional testing
Plans and drives user acceptance testing execution including engagement of business stakeholders and sign-off activities.
Change Management/ Training
Engages Change Management and Training team to facilitate the development of project communication plan and development/ execution of training of larger scale projects via regular checkpoints and status updates.
Ensures that Change Management and Training team have information needed to create training materials and project communications.
Accountable for adoption of solutions by sponsoring business departments
Post Go Live Support:
Lead project hypercare planning and execution
Facilitate lessons learned/retrospective discussions
Education and Experience:
Bachelors degree required
5+ years Project Management or / 7+ years as a Senior Business Analyst experience
Biotech/Life Science industry experience is preferred.
Salesforce experience preferred.
Knowledge and prior experience in Agile Scrum SDLC and release management preferred
Experience working in projects where multiple functions work in a matrix structure
Ability to quickly learn details of multiple IT systems, integrations and cloud applications
Demonstrated excellence in critical thinking and analysis, small and large group facilitation, and presentation skills.
Demonstrated ability/experience in thinking at a high-level but have the ability to get into details
Excellent interpersonal, verbal and written communication skills.
Ability to work comfortably at all levels within the organization up to the senior management level.
